Job description

Position Summary: The Senior Machine Learning Engineer will play a key role in leading the design, development, and deployment of machine learning solutions. You will collaborate with cross-functional teams to identify business opportunities, develop innovative machine learning models, and implement scalable solutions that drive business value. This role offers a unique opportunity to leverage your expertise in machine learning to tackle challenging problems, mentor junior team members, and contribute to the success of our organization.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ead the design, development, and deployment of machine learning models and algorithms to solve complex business problems.
  • Collaborate with data scientists, software engineers, and product managers to identify business opportunities and requirements.
  • Conduct exploratory data analysis, feature engineering, and model evaluation to ensure robust and reliable performance.
  • Implement scalable and efficient machine learning pipelines and workflows to process large volumes of data.
  • Stay up-to-date with the latest developments in machine learning research and technologies, and apply them to improve our products and services.
  • Mentor and coach junior machine learning engineers, providing guidance, training, and support to develop their technical skills and knowledge.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to integrate machine learning models into production systems and applications.
  • Document work processes, methodologies, and best practices to facilitate knowledge sharing and collaboration.

Qualifications:

  • Master's or Ph.D. degree in Computer Science, Statistics, Mathematics, or a related field (or equivalent experience).
  • 5+ years of experience in machine learning engineering or related roles, with a proven track record of developing and deploying machine learning solutions in production environments.
  • Strong proficiency in machine learning algorithms, techniques, and frameworks such as TensorFlow, PyTorch, scikit-learn, or Spark MLlib.
  • Experience with big data technologies and platforms such as Hadoop, Spark, or Apache Flink.
  • Proficiency in programming languages such as Python, Java, or Scala.
  •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ills, with a strong attention to detail.
  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ills, with the ability to effectively work with cross-functional teams.
  • Demonstrated leadership and mentoring abilities, with a passion for developing and empowering team members.
